Learning through Teaching

There should be a new form of study which is conducted not as a test-based, regurgitate facts system, but where the learner finds out all they can about something, then sits down and explains the whole thing to someone who knows about it. They would then ask questions, suggest areas to brush up on, and provide other knowledge they might know.

A test could be constructed, where the student explains all about the particular unit of study to someone who has no idea about it. The success of the student in learning is gauged by how well the third person knows the subject. Thus, the student becomes the teacher, observed and improved upon by another teacher, and as far up that loop as you wish to go.

It would make the learner actually think about what they were told, and raise questions to ask the teacher, not only your questions, but those of who the learner explains it to as well.
